How to Pronounce Basic Japanese Sounds
There are 46 basic sounds in Japanese. The first five sounds (a, i, u, e, o) are vowels, and the rest of the sounds are a combination of a vowel and a consonant. I think Japanese is easy to pronounce when compared to other languages.
However, some people might find the pronunciation of "r" and "f" difficult. Please check out my explanation about the sounds of "r" and "f". You can also check out the "Hiragana Audio Chart", which shows all 46 hiragana sounds.

Japanese Counters
Each language has a different way of counting objects. In Japanese, different categories of objects have specific counters associated with them. It is similar to English phrases such as "slices of ~" "pair of ~" "cup of ~" and so on. Please checkout my "Counters" page to learn more about them.
